1. A power module assembly comprising:

  • a primary cooling circuit comprising a reactor vessel and a reactor core surrounded by a primary coolant, the primary cooling circuit configured to promote a natural circulation flowpath within the reactor vessel;

    a containment vessel submerged in a containment cooling pool and configured to prohibit release of the primary coolant outside of the containment vessel;

    a heat exchanger disposed within the containment vessel in fluid communication with the primary coolant, the heat exchanger configured to remove heat from the primary coolant;

    a secondary cooling circuit including a steam generation circuit configured to generate steam, using heat extracted from the primary coolant, to drive a turbine;

    an emergency cooling system, isolated from the steam generation circuit, and configured to be coupled to the heat exchanger during emergency operation to remove heat from the primary coolant via natural circulation of an emergency coolant, without a pump or external power source.
